The Science of Omega-3 Rancidity

Omega-3 fatty acids, particularly those derived from fish oil (EPA and DHA), are highly susceptible to a chemical process called oxidation, which leads to rancidity. This occurs when the oil is exposed to heat, light, and oxygen, which causes the fatty acids to break down and form harmful compounds called aldehydes and peroxides.

Rancid omega-3 doesn't just taste and smell bad; it also loses its nutritional potency and can potentially cause negative health effects, such as oxidative stress in the body. Quality manufacturers take steps to minimize oxidation during production, but once the product is opened and exposed to air, the process accelerates.

Key Sensory Indicators of Spoiled Omega-3

Your senses are your first and best line of defense against consuming rancid omega-3. Here is a guide to what to look for, smell for, and taste for.

The Smell Test

Fresh, high-quality fish oil should have a neutral or very mild, pleasant oceanic scent, similar to fresh fish. If you detect a strong, pungent, sour, or noticeably unpleasant fishy odor, it's a clear sign the oil has oxidized and gone bad. For capsules, you can bite or cut one open to get an accurate sniff test. Some flavored supplements may try to mask this rancid smell, so it is important to be cautious.

The Taste Test

Just like the smell, the taste of fresh fish oil should not be harsh or unpleasant. If your supplement has a bitter, sour, or overly fishy flavor that makes you recoil, it has likely gone rancid. A side effect of rancid omega-3 is also often fishy burps, which can be an immediate indication of a problem.

The Visual Test

While less common, you can sometimes see signs of rancidity. Examine the color and clarity of the oil.

  • Cloudiness or discoloration: Fresh liquid omega-3 should be clear. If it appears cloudy, darker, or has changed in color, it's a visual cue that it has degraded.
  • Capsule appearance: Check the softgels themselves. If they are clumped together, stuck to the side of the bottle, or show signs of deterioration, the quality has been compromised.

The Timing Test

Always check the expiration or 'best by' date printed on the bottle. While this is not a perfect indicator, as improper storage can cause oxidation before this date, it provides a crucial reference point. If the supplement is past its expiration date, its potency is reduced, and it should be discarded.

Comparison of Fresh vs. Rancid Omega-3

Feature Fresh Omega-3 Oil Rancid (Oxidized) Omega-3 Oil
Smell Neutral or mild oceanic aroma. Strong, sour, or unpleasant "rotten fish" smell.
Taste Mild and palatable. Bitter, sour, or very strong fishy aftertaste.
Appearance Clear and consistent in color. Cloudy, darker, or discolored.
After-effects No significant or unpleasant aftertaste or burps. Distinctive and unpleasant fishy burps.
Potency Fully potent, providing intended health benefits. Reduced effectiveness; potentially offers no benefits.
Safety Considered safe and beneficial for consumption. Can cause digestive upset and may increase oxidative stress.

Preventative Measures and Best Practices

Proper Storage

  • Keep it cool: Store omega-3 supplements in a cool, dark place, away from direct sunlight. A refrigerator is often the best place, especially for liquid oils, as the cold temperature slows down the oxidation process.
  • Avoid heat and humidity: Do not store supplements in warm, humid places like a bathroom medicine cabinet or near a stove.
  • Seal tightly: Always ensure the bottle or container is tightly sealed after each use to minimize exposure to oxygen.

Smart Purchasing Decisions

  • Choose reputable brands: Select products from manufacturers known for quality and transparency, often indicated by independent third-party testing.
  • Look for antioxidants: High-quality omega-3 supplements often include antioxidants like Vitamin E to protect the oil from oxidation.
  • Check the TOTOX value: Some brands voluntarily provide the Total Oxidation (TOTOX) value on their Certificate of Analysis. A lower TOTOX value indicates fresher oil.

The Health Implications of Rancidity

While ingesting a single rancid capsule is unlikely to cause serious harm, consistently taking oxidized omega-3 can be counterproductive to your health goals. Instead of reducing inflammation and supporting health, oxidized fats may contribute to free radical formation and cellular damage, undoing the benefits you sought in the first place. Studies have shown that fresh fish oil can deliver positive health outcomes, whereas rancid oil can negatively impact cholesterol levels.
